Output 65bd51a4ebfda1ad76fb0225d45f0727f7d45b1934cddf5ca3407c7dc2758680:6

value
17218631
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c699bce9a4db1f8531feb4708cec8457b1d4b84 OP_EQUALVERIFY OP_CHECKSIG
address
1DoS7fyHbBKjjz6LtvFghkGTkBusCgGc4a
transaction
65bd51a4ebfda1ad76fb0225d45f0727f7d45b1934cddf5ca3407c7dc2758680
confirmations
511882
spent
true